When to walk in Nepal, region by region
October is not the only answer, and for four of our eight regions it is not the best one.
Ask when to trek in Nepal and you will be told October. It is not wrong — post-monsoon October is spectacular — but it is also when every lodge is full and the trail out of Namche moves at the pace of the slowest group on it.
The four seasons, briefly
Autumn, from late September to November, is the peak: stable weather, clear air washed clean by the monsoon, and cold arriving through November. Spring, March to May, is warmer and hazier with rhododendron in flower and the climbing season in full swing.
Winter, December to February, is clear, empty and genuinely cold, with the high passes closed. The monsoon, June to early September, shuts most of the country down — except for the two regions in the rain shadow.
Region by region
| Region | Best | Also good | Avoid |
|---|---|---|---|
| Everest & Khumbu | Oct–Nov | Mar–May | Jun–Aug |
| Annapurna | Oct–Nov | Feb–May, Dec | Jul–Aug |
| Mustang | May–Sep | Mar–Apr, Oct | Dec–Jan |
| Langtang | Oct–Dec | Mar–May | Jul–Aug |
| Manaslu | Oct–Nov | Mar–Apr | Jun–Sep, Dec–Feb |
| Dolpo | Jun–Aug | May, Sep | Nov–Apr |
| Kanchenjunga & the east | Oct–Nov | Apr–May | Jun–Sep |
| Kathmandu Valley | Oct–Mar | Apr, Sep | Jun–Aug |
The two monsoon exceptions
Mustang and Dolpo sit north of the main Himalayan range, in the rain shadow. While the rest of Nepal is under cloud from June to September, both are dry, walkable and almost empty. If your only free month is July, this is the answer rather than a consolation.
In July people ask me if the trip is still on. In Mustang, July is the trip.
Pasang Lama, Mustang guide
The case for December
Below 4,000 m, December in Nepal is superb: the clearest air of the year, empty lodges and prices that reflect it. It is cold at night and the high passes are shut, but Langtang, Poon Hill and the whole Kathmandu Valley are at their best and you will have them largely to yourself.
